We are the perfect away side. We set traps for them all over the pitch and they fell for them every time.

We invited their fullbacks forward, giving Albrighton acres of space, in turn setting Vardy free to work the channels.

We forced them to delay putting the ball into the box, meaning we got ourselves set and ready for Kante to exploit the oceans of space that Toure left.

We pour people forward in great numbers, but so intelligently. No one screams for the pass, they each make a different run, stretching the defence to then allow the passer to pick the best option.

We mercilessly punished two set pieces and a sloppy turnover of possession for the goals.

We got a comfortable lead and then gave Man City a lesson in swift, accurate ball retention to kill the game and save our legs for 10 minutes.

Perfect tactics, perfectly executed by a team of superheroes.
